Output 58b0db331a4a07cc077ea594e6e6c275213e7847ef76db7ddfda2a48643c723a:890

value
27997
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 95d5827112601f6dc381668400d0dface28d9376b89e660e9f03f97719e0f825
address
bc1pjh2cyugjvq0kmsupv6zqp5xl4n3gmymkhz0xvr5lq0uhwx0qlqjsmdzgme
transaction
58b0db331a4a07cc077ea594e6e6c275213e7847ef76db7ddfda2a48643c723a
spent
true